Also, just for fun, I did the 'bit o' wood impact test' between the FTTs and FTT Greens...... ..... 25yrds into a piece of damp pallet wood. The Greens make a loud knock on impact but, the FTTs definitely penetrate better I may come back to the Greens for some more testing one day but, for now, the normal FTTs are looking very good so, I want to learn how they perform and generally get a feel for what they're capable of. -

Someone recently gave me some Napier Power Pellet lube. I tried this once ages ago and it opened my groups right up (different rifle and pellet) so, I wrote it off as BS. Anyway, after thinking about, I lubed a few of the new FTTs. Straight away they cycled smoother and, without touching the windage and elevation, they shifted the point of impact to just above my point of aim and gave a very tight group I'm out ratting tonight - I reckon this combo is going to be devastating -
